2. Safety Information

To prevent personal injury or property damage, always follow basic safety precautions when using electrical products. This timer is ETL Listed, ensuring it meets recognized safety standards.

  • Risk of Electric Shock: Do not immerse in water. Do not use if the housing or cord is damaged.
  • Grounding: This product must be properly grounded. Ensure the outlet it is plugged into is a grounded outlet.
  • Overload Protection: Do not exceed the electrical ratings of 125V/15A/1875W, 1/2HP.
  • Installation: Mount the timer vertically at least 2 feet (0.6 meters) above the ground to ensure optimal waterproof performance.
  • Children: Keep out of reach of children.
  • Maintenance: Disconnect power before cleaning or performing any maintenance.

3. Product Overview

The G-ELEK Outdoor Timer Outlet is a robust mechanical timer designed for outdoor use. Key components and features include:

  • 24-Hour Dial: A rotating dial with 30-minute segments for setting ON/OFF times.
  • Push-Down Pins: Integrated pins around the dial that control the ON/OFF cycles. Each pin represents 30 minutes.
  • Manual Override Switch: A slide switch to toggle between timer mode (⏱) and always-ON mode (I).
  • Dual Grounded Outlets: Two 3-prong grounded outlets for connecting appliances.
  • Weatherproof Cover: A clear, hinged cover protects the dial and switch from dust, debris, and moisture.
  • Heavy-Duty Cord: 6-inch 14AWGx3C SJTW UL approved PVC cable with a right-angle plug.

4. Setup

Follow these steps to set up your G-ELEK Outdoor Timer Outlet:

  1. Choose a Location: Select a suitable outdoor location near a grounded electrical outlet. Ensure the location allows for vertical mounting and is at least 2 feet (0.6 meters) above the ground to maximize weather protection.
  2. Mount the Timer: Use the integrated wall mount hole on the back of the timer to securely fasten it to a wall or sturdy surface.
  3. Plug In the Timer: Connect the timer's power cord to a grounded 125V electrical outlet.
  4. Connect Appliances: Plug your outdoor appliances (e.g., lights, pool pump) into the two grounded outlets on the timer. Ensure the total load does not exceed 1875W (15A).

5. Operating Instructions

Programming the G-ELEK timer involves three main steps:

  1. Set the Current Time: Rotate the entire timer dial clockwise until the "TIME NOW" arrow points to the current time. The dial is marked with 24 hours (1-12 AM and 1-12 PM).
  2. Set ON/OFF Times: The dial has small pins around its circumference. Each pin represents a 30-minute interval.
    • To set an appliance to turn ON, push the corresponding pins DOWN for the desired duration.
    • To set an appliance to turn OFF, leave the corresponding pins in the UP position.

    You can set up to 48 ON/OFF programs per 24-hour cycle.

  3. Select Operating Mode: Use the slide switch located on the side of the timer to choose the desired mode:
    • Slide to ⏱ (Timer Function): The timer will operate according to your programmed ON/OFF settings.
    • Slide to I (Always ON): The connected appliances will remain continuously powered, bypassing the timer settings.

6. Maintenance

Proper maintenance ensures the longevity and reliable operation of your G-ELEK timer.

  • Cleaning: Disconnect the timer from the power source before cleaning. Wipe the exterior with a soft, damp cloth. Do not use har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
  • Weather Protection: While designed to be weatherproof, ensure the clear protective cover is always securely closed when the timer is in use outdoors. Regularly check for any cracks or damage to the cover.
  • Storage: If storing the timer for an extended period, disconnect it from power, clean it, and store it in a dry, cool place away from direct sunlight.

7.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your G-ELEK timer, refer to the following common problems and solutions:

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Appliance does not turn ON/OFF at programmed times.
  • Timer dial not set to current time.
  • Pins not pushed down/pulled up correctly.
  • Manual override switch set to 'Always ON' (I).
  • Power outage.
  • Rotate dial to align "TIME NOW" with current time.
  • Ensure pins are correctly set for ON (down) and OFF (up) periods.
  • Slide switch to ⏱ (Timer Function).
  • Reset current time after power is restored.
Appliance is always ON or always OFF.
  • Manual override switch set incorrectly.
  • All pins are pushed down (always ON) or all pins are up (always OFF).
  • Slide switch to ⏱ (Timer Function).
  • Adjust pins to create desired ON/OFF cycles.
Timer is not receiving power.
  • Outlet is not functioning.
  • Circuit breaker tripped.
  • Test the outlet with another device.
  • Check and reset the circuit breaker.

8. Specifications

Model Number30ULD/3AO
Electrical Rating125V AC, 60Hz, 15A, 1875W Resistive/Tungsten, 1/2 HP
Number of Outlets2 Grounded Outlets
Minimum ON/OFF Time30 minutes
Daily ProgramsUp to 48 ON/OFF settings per 24 hours
Cord Length6 inches (14AWGx3C SJTW UL approved PVC cable)
MaterialPlastic
Dimensions (approx.)6.1"D x 3.5"W x 1.9"H
CertificationsETL Listed
